diff --git a/.github/workflows/3d.yml b/.github/workflows/3d.yml index 7d1065ee..ccad7008 100644 --- a/.github/workflows/3d.yml +++ b/.github/workflows/3d.yml @@ -20,7 +20,7 @@ jobs: - name: 'Generate 2d output :: 52 flap :: generic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--render-raster +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python -u 3d/scripts/generate_2d.py --calculate-dimensions --render-raster c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-52.svg cp 3d/build/laser_parts/raster.png 3d/build/outputs/3d_laser_raster-52.png ./scripts/annotate_image.sh 3d/build/outputs/3d_laser_raster-52.png @@ -28,26 +28,26 @@ jobs: - name: 'Generate 2d output :: 52 flap :: Ponoko 3mm MDF)'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--kerf-preset ponoko-3mm-mdf +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--calculate-dimensions --kerf-preset ponoko-3mm-mdf c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-52-ponoko-3mm-mdf_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-52-ponoko-3mm-mdf_1x_dimensions.svg - name: 'Generate 2d output :: 52 flap :: Ponoko 3mm Acrylic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--kerf-preset ponoko-3mm-acrylic +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--calculate-dimensions --kerf-preset ponoko-3mm-acrylic c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-52-ponoko-3mm-acrylic_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-52-ponoko-3mm-acrylic_1x_dimensions.svg - name: 'Generate 2d output :: 52 flap :: Elecrow 3mm Wood'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--kerf-preset elecrow-3mm-wood --render-elecrow +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--kerf-preset elecrow-3mm-wood --render-elecrow c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-wood_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-wood_1x_dimensions.svg cp 3d/build/laser_parts/elecrow.zip 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-wood_1x.zip - name: 'Generate 2d output :: 52 flap :: Elecrow 3mm Acrylic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--kerf-preset elecrow-3mm-acrylic --render-elecrow +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--kerf-preset elecrow-3mm-acrylic --render-elecrow c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-acrylic_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-acrylic_1x_dimensions.svg cp 3d/build/laser_parts/elecrow.zip 3d/build/outputs/3d_laser_vector-52-elecrow-3mm-acrylic_1x.zip @@ -55,7 +55,7 @@ jobs: - name: 'Generate 2d output :: 40 flap :: generic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--render-raster --num-flaps 40 +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python -u 3d/scripts/generate_2d.py --calculate-dimensions --render-raster --num-flaps 40 c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-40.svg cp 3d/build/laser_parts/raster.png 3d/build/outputs/3d_laser_raster-40.png ./scripts/annotate_image.sh 3d/build/outputs/3d_laser_raster-40.png @@ -63,26 +63,26 @@ jobs: - name: 'Generate 2d output :: 40 flap :: Ponoko 3mm MDF)'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--kerf-preset ponoko-3mm-mdf --num-flaps 40 +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--calculate-dimensions --kerf-preset ponoko-3mm-mdf --num-flaps 40 c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-40-ponoko-3mm-mdf_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-40-ponoko-3mm-mdf_1x_dimensions.svg - name: 'Generate 2d output :: 40 flap :: Ponoko 3mm Acrylic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--calculate-dimensions --kerf-preset ponoko-3mm-acrylic --num-flaps 40 +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--calculate-dimensions --kerf-preset ponoko-3mm-acrylic --num-flaps 40 c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-40-ponoko-3mm-acrylic_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-40-ponoko-3mm-acrylic_1x_dimensions.svg - name: 'Generate 2d output :: 40 flap :: Elecrow 3mm Wood'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--kerf-preset elecrow-3mm-wood --render-elecrow --num-flaps 40 +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--kerf-preset elecrow-3mm-wood --render-elecrow --num-flaps 40 c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-wood_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-wood_1x_dimensions.svg cp 3d/build/laser_parts/elecrow.zip 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-wood_1x.zip - name: 'Generate 2d output :: 40 flap :: Elecrow 3mm Acrylic' run: | - x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--no-connectors --kerf-preset elecrow-3mm-acrylic --render-elecrow --num-flaps 40 + xvfb-run --auto-servernum --server-args "-screen 0 1024x768x24" python3 -u 3d/scripts/generate_2d.py --kerf-preset elecrow-3mm-acrylic --render-elecrow --num-flaps 40 cp 3d/build/laser_parts/combined.svg 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-acrylic_1x.svg cp 3d/build/laser_parts/combined_panel_dimensions.svg 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-acrylic_1x_dimensions.svg cp 3d/build/laser_parts/elecrow.zip 3d/build/outputs/3d_laser_vector-40-elecrow-3mm-acrylic_1x.zip